Pythonicな方法だと"pass"ですね
Trac Tickets - Bulknews::Subtech より
Trac のチケットUIをデフォルトの Report ではなくて Query にしてるんだけど、認証してログインした状態だと、デフォルトで自分が Owner なチケットしかでてくれない。というわけで、http://plagger.org/trac/query を見ても、ログインした状態だと何も見えてなかった(自分で Owner is を - ではずして Update すれば見えるけど)。これはあんまよくないので Tracコードをハック(trac/ticket/query.py)。constraints の行をコメントアウトしただけだと構文エラーになった。影響なさそうな文をいれて回避。たぶんもっと Pythonic な方法があるんだろうけど。
Pythonicな方法だと、"pass"ですね。こんな感じ。
if req.authname and req.authname != 'anonymous':
pass
#constraints['owner'] = (req.authname,)
else:
こうして見ると、Perlのスーパーハカーなmiyagawaさんが使ってたり、Ruby on Railsの本家でも使われてたりして、つくづくTracはキラーアプリなんだと思った。ウノウは影舞なわけだけど。
関連リンク:









